Cody Rhodes heel plans

1 of 6
WWE: Sunday Night's Main Event

The Rumor

Is Cody Rhodes finally a bad guy? Maybe not. According to WrestleVotes (h/t Geno Mrosko of Cageside Seats), vicious actions by Rhodes against Randy Orton recently are not a sign of things to come for him as a heel.

Reaction

Rhodes certainly hinted at some heelish things during his match with Orton at Sunday Night's Main Event. And it's not even close to the first time he's hinted at making a full-blown turn.ย 

BS Meter: 5

Call it 50-50. Rhodes pretty infamously didn't seem to want to go heel in AEW. But his WWE run has had plenty of hints at doing just that. Maybe they're really slow-burning it this time and will save the full turn for an even bigger event. Might as well invest in the long-term story some more at this point, right?

Bayley WWE-AEW buzz

2 of 6
Monday Night RAW

The Rumor

So much for Bayley going to AEW. According to Fightful (h/t Mrosko), Bayley's recent WWE return doesn't necessarily mean that AEW is giving up hope because, prior to the return, they had hopes to make a play for her in free agency.ย 

Reaction

Bayley was doing a really good job of drumming up buzz for herself by hinting at a change recently. But her return to Raw recently would seemingly shut down anything about going to AEW, for better or worse.ย 

BS Meter: 1

Of course AEW had an interest in Bayley for a very long list of reasons that would keep us locked here for far too long. It's hard to imagine, from a very basic business perspective, though, that she reappeared on WWE television without a new deal.

More AEW signings buzz

3 of 6
Monday Night RAW

The Rumor

Elsewhere on the AEW-pursuing-wrestlers front, according to Fightful's Sean Ross Sapp (h/t Cain A. Knight of Cageside Seats), the promotion had talks with Kairi Sane, but it was never realistic for her to join before last month's All In.ย 

Reaction

The report even goes on to mention that there is "nothing imminent" on this topic. That shuts down plenty of (fair) fan sentiment that Sane going to AEW was a mere matter of time, given the fit.ย 

BS Meter: 1

Everything looks good here. We can't know the particulars of what Sane wants on her next deal or otherwise. But it's blatantly obvious that she's a massive international free agent who can take all the time she wants to make her pick of the many promotions undoubtedly after her.ย 

WWE start times update

4 of 6
WWE Crown Jewel

The Rumor

WWE has four major PLEs left and a smattering of other things. According to WrestleVotes (h/t Knight), the promotion has put Worlds Collide at 8 p.m. ET to "directly compete" with AEW's All Out.ย 

Reaction

No shocker here, as this is WWE habit by now. Also, of note, is Wrestle Inc's Nishant Jayaram citing the same report as 6 p.m. ET starts for Money in the Bank and Survivor Series: WarGames. Crown Jewel is set for 1 p.m. ET and WrestlePalooza, from Perth, Australia, will start at 6 a.m. ET.ย 

BS Meter: 1

Times always subject to change, of course. One thing that isn't? WWE insisting on acting like AEW isn't direct competition while also making sure to counter-program it. Propping up smaller brands to directly compete, too, is a very WWE thing to do, for better or worse.ย ย 

WWE andโ€ฆDisney?

5 of 6
Monday Night RAW

The Rumor

Here comes Disney chatter. According to WrestleVotes (h/t Knight),WWE has plans to hopefully use ESPN Wide World of Sports Complex in Orlando for brand awareness events, plus hopes that wrestlers can actually make it onto some sort of Disney+ programming.ย 

Reaction

Let this report tell it, WWE has desired a Disney connect before the ESPN deal even came together. No matter what happens with ESPN moving forward, one would presume that stance won't change.ย 

BS Meter: 1

Easiest buy of the week, really. Of course WWE wants to expand into as many avenues as it can, never mind one as big as Disney. We'll see how serious things get, but it's an obvious way to appeal to younger generations of would-be fans.

Oba Femi, Bronson Reed drama latest

6 of 6
Monday Night RAW

The Rumor

It's the most popular rumor buzzing right now: Do Oba Femi and Bronson Reed have real beef? According to WrestleVotes (h/t Knight), some backstage in WWE aren't thrilled about the interaction on Raw this past week when Femi reacted violently to Reed putting a boot on him at the end of a segment.ย 

Reaction

Talk about storyline-bait. WWE is as scripted as it gets these days, so it's hard to imagine this was unplanned. Either way, there's now a blurred-lines effect perplexing fans as the foundation for a great main-event feud has been set.ย 

BS Meter: 10

Come on. Even if this wasn't planned, WWE has a million different ways to frame this and make it fun (Oba was using his last gasp of fight to stop the disrespect!). Any random number of people backstage could have been "surprised" by the events. It's a money start to a feud, regardless, and no doubt WWE knows it.
